E-Beam Controller Market Summary

As per MRFR analysis, the E-Beam Controller Market Size was estimated at 0.8215 USD Billion in 2024. The E-Beam industry is projected to grow from 0.8666 in 2025 to 1.478 by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.48 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

Key Market Trends & Highlights

The E-Beam Controller Market is poised for substantial growth driven by technological advancements and increasing demand across various sectors.

  • North America remains the largest market for E-Beam Controllers, primarily due to its robust semiconductor manufacturing sector.
  • Asia-Pacific is emerging as the fastest-growing region, fueled by rapid advancements in 3D printing technologies.
  • The semiconductor manufacturing segment dominates the market, while the healthcare segment is witnessing the fastest growth.
  • Key market drivers include the rising demand for advanced manufacturing and a growing focus on energy efficiency.

Market Size & Forecast

2024 Market Size 0.8215 (USD Billion)
2035 Market Size 1.478 (USD Billion)
CAGR (2025 - 2035) 5.48%

Major Players

Applied Materials (US), Thermo Fisher Scientific (US), Hitachi High-Technologies (JP), JEOL (JP), Carl Zeiss AG (DE), KLA Corporation (US), Nikon Corporation (JP), MKS Instruments (US), Oxford Instruments (GB)

E-Beam Controller Market Drivers

Expansion of Semiconductor Industry

The expansion of the semiconductor industry is a key driver for the E-Beam Controller Market. With the increasing demand for electronic devices and components, semiconductor manufacturers are investing heavily in advanced fabrication technologies. E-Beam controllers play a crucial role in the lithography process, enabling the production of smaller and more efficient chips. As the semiconductor market is expected to reach a valuation of over 500 billion dollars by 2026, the E-Beam Controller Market stands to gain significantly from this growth, as manufacturers seek to enhance their production capabilities.

By Type: Single Beam Systems (Largest) vs. Multi Beam Systems (Fastest-Growing)

The E-Beam Controller Market is primarily segmented into Single Beam Systems, Multi Beam Systems, and Nanoscale E-Beam Systems. Among these, Single Beam Systems hold the largest market share, attributed to their established presence in the industry and widespread applications in semiconductor manufacturing. Multi Beam Systems, although relatively new, are rapidly gaining traction due to their ability to enhance throughput in advanced lithography processes, thereby capturing an increasing portion of the market.

Single Beam Systems (Dominant) vs. Multi Beam Systems (Emerging)

Single Beam Systems are characterized by their reliability and efficiency in producing high-quality outputs essential for semiconductor applications. These systems dominate the market due to their proven technology and extensive installation base. In contrast, Multi Beam Systems emerging as a competitive solution, offer significant advantages in speed and precision, making them ideal for next-generation applications. Their ability to process multiple beams simultaneously positions them as a transformative force in the market, catering to the increasing demand for higher resolution and faster production speeds. As manufacturers seek to innovate and reduce cycle times, Multi Beam Systems are anticipated to become a pivotal part of the E-Beam landscape.

Regional Insights

North America : Innovation and Technology Hub

North America is the largest market for E-Beam Controllers, holding approximately 45% of the global market share. The region's growth is driven by advancements in semiconductor manufacturing, increasing demand for high-precision equipment, and supportive government regulations promoting technological innovation. The presence of major players like Applied Materials and KLA Corporation further fuels market expansion, alongside a robust research and development ecosystem. The United States dominates the North American market, with significant contributions from Canada. The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of established companies and emerging startups, focusing on innovative solutions to meet the evolving needs of the semiconductor industry. Key players such as Thermo Fisher Scientific and MKS Instruments are actively investing in R&D to enhance their product offerings and maintain market leadership.

Europe : Emerging Market with Growth Potential

Europe is witnessing a growing demand for E-Beam Controllers, accounting for approximately 30% of the global market share. The region's growth is propelled by increasing investments in semiconductor manufacturing and a strong focus on sustainability and energy efficiency. Regulatory frameworks, such as the European Green Deal, are encouraging the adoption of advanced technologies, which is expected to further boost market growth in the coming years. Germany and France are the leading countries in this market, with a strong presence of key players like Carl Zeiss AG and Oxford Instruments. The competitive landscape is evolving, with companies focusing on innovation and strategic partnerships to enhance their market position. The region's emphasis on research and development is fostering a conducive environment for the growth of E-Beam Controllers, making it a significant player in the global market.

Asia-Pacific : Rapidly Growing Semiconductor Sector

Asia-Pacific is the second-largest market for E-Beam Controllers, holding around 25% of the global market share. The region's growth is driven by the booming semiconductor industry, particularly in countries like China, Japan, and South Korea. Increasing investments in technology and manufacturing capabilities, along with government initiatives to boost local production, are key factors contributing to market expansion. The demand for high-precision equipment is also on the rise, further fueling growth in this sector. China is the largest contributor in the Asia-Pacific region, followed by Japan and South Korea. The competitive landscape is marked by the presence of major players such as Hitachi High-Technologies and JEOL, who are investing heavily in R&D to innovate and improve their product offerings. The region's focus on technological advancement and collaboration among industry stakeholders is expected to drive further growth in the E-Beam Controller Market.
